Understanding imToken Wallet Fees

  • Types of Fees
  • When using imToken, the fees can typically be divided into two categories: network fees and service fees.

    Network Fees: These are fees charged by the blockchain network itself for processing transactions. Since imToken supports various cryptocurrencies, such as Ethereum and others, the network fees will vary depending on the cryptocurrency being used and the current network congestion.

    Service Fees: imToken may charge service fees for specific features such as swaps or advanced trading functions. These fees are relatively minor compared to network fees.

    Practical Tips to Minimize imToken Fees

    To navigate through transaction fees efficiently, here are several strategies to maintain low costs while using the imToken wallet.

  • Monitor Network Conditions
  • Understanding when the network is congested can save you considerable fees. Use tools like Ethereum gas trackers to identify lowtraffic periods for sending transactions.

    Example: If you notice that gas prices are significantly lower late at night, consider scheduling your transactions for those times to optimize your fees.

  • Select Appropriate Gas Fees
  • imToken allows users to adjust their gas fees. For nonurgent transactions, setting a lower gas price is possible, which can reduce fees substantially.

    Example: When making a transaction, opting for a "slow" setting can lead to a lower fee compared to a "fast" option, which prioritizes immediate processing but at a cost.

  • Batch Transactions
  • If you plan to conduct multiple transactions, consider batching them into one transaction where possible. This reduces the number of individual transaction fees incurred.

    Example: Transferring multiple tokens in a single transaction instead of several separate ones minimizes the overall fees.

  • Using ERC20 and BEP20 Tokens Wisely
  • If you are dealing with Ethereumbased (ERC20) or Binance Smart Chainbased (BEP20) tokens, be mindful of the transaction fees. Using tokens on a less congested blockchain can significantly reduce costs.

    Example: If possible, opt for tokens that utilize the Binance Smart Chain for lower fees compared to Ethereum networks.

    Frequent Concerns about imToken Fees

  • Why are network fees sometimes so high?
  • Network fees fluctuate based on demand for transaction processing on the blockchain. During high traffic periods, miners can charge more to prioritize transactions.

  • Is there a fixed fee for using imToken?
  • No, imToken does not charge a fixed service fee for transactions; the charges depend on the blockchain's network fees and any optional services you choose.

  • How does imToken ensure fee transparency?
  • imToken provides transaction estimations before confirmation, allowing users to understand potential fees before proceeding.

  • Can I avoid fees entirely?
  • While it’s impossible to avoid network fees on blockchain, using the strategies outlined above can help you reduce overall costs significantly.

  • Are there hidden fees associated with imToken?
  • All fees should be disclosed clearly in the app; remain vigilant and read all transaction details before confirming.

  • How often do fees change?
  • Network fees can change frequently based on various factors, including blockchain congestion, the specific cryptocurrency being transferred, and macroeconomic conditions affecting the cryptocurrency market.
